Sunday, January 15<br />

Stations of the Dream: To Walk Where<br />

Civil Rights Heroes Walked<br />

The Chapel, <strong>Barrington</strong> Hills, 2 –3:30 p.m.<br />

This 3rd annual MLK Celebration will feature<br />

an interactive experiential afternoon with the<br />

opportunity to engage in events that led up<br />

to the Civil Rights Act of 1964. Join us for this<br />

powerful journey into our nation’s past and<br />

an opportunity to talk about what we learn<br />

and how it might shape today and tomorrow.<br />

Appropriate for ages 8+. An MLK activity<br />

room will be provided for younger children.<br />

$5/person; maximum $20/family. For more<br />

information visit www.stationsofthedream.com.<br />

The Chapel is located at 180 N. Hawthorne Rd.<br />

in <strong>Barrington</strong> Hills.<br />

Friday, January 10<br />

Youth Arts Alive<br />

BHS Auditorium, Starts at 7:30 p.m.<br />

The <strong>Barrington</strong> Area Drug Prevention Coalition<br />

(BADPC) is sponsoring this fun and free event.<br />

The evening will consist of several local arts<br />

organizations including, Bataille Academie<br />

of the Danse, <strong>Barrington</strong> Suzuki, <strong>Barrington</strong><br />

Youth Orchestra, <strong>Barrington</strong> Children’s Choir,<br />

Bel Canto Studios, Consolidated Music, and<br />

Kaleidoscope School of Art. Each of these<br />

organizations will perform and highlight their<br />

program. Funds raised from concessions and<br />

donations will benefit BADPC.<br />

Wellness Place Gala<br />

Wellness Place celebrated its “Art of the Human Spirit” Auxiliary Gala at The Art Institute of<br />

Chicago on Saturday, October 8. Supporters of the organization gathered for an evening of<br />

art, laughter, learning and giving as they raised their glasses and paddles in support of those<br />

facing cancer from our community.<br />

“I couldn’t believe the amazing weather we had – the outdoor atrium with its vintage<br />

fountains and white lights, surrounded by the Chicago skyline – were a perfect setting<br />

for the cocktail hour … a beautiful start to a lovely evening,” said Wellness Place Board<br />

Chairwoman, Ellaine Sambo-Reyther.<br />

Guides were on hand for personally conducted tours of exhibits including the Chagall<br />

Windows and “Windows on the War”. Dinner was held in the historic Stock Exchange Room<br />

where guests enjoyed the relocated elaborate stenciled decorations, molded plaster capitals<br />

and art glass originally designed for the Stock Exchange by Louis Sullivan in 1893.<br />

The program included presentation of the Pat and Vince Foglia Award for Loyalty and<br />

Commitment to Shefali Bhuva of South <strong>Barrington</strong>.<br />

Proceeds benefit Wellness Place cancer-related counseling, education and support<br />

programs provided at no charge to survivors, their family, friends and caregivers.<br />

Wellness Place is a community-based center in Palatine serving people who are diagnosed<br />

with cancer, their family and caregivers. For more information on Wellness Place, visit www.<br />

wellnessplace.org or call 847-221-2400.<br />
